Hope for small businesses as Covid-19 reopening plan announced

Commenting on the Government’s reopening plan announced ton Thursday evening, Sven Spollen-Behrens, Director of the Small Firms Association (SFA) said: “Small firms will be incredibly pleased to hear that we now have some indicative dates for a wider reopening of business and society, particularly in the non-essential retail, hair and beauty and hospitality sectors, as well as those operating in the Experience Economy. This is something that SFA has been pressing for and we are pleased to see Government has taken on board business concerns.
“This announcement will give hope to many business owners and their staff, allowing them to plan for a safe and successful reopening that will benefit both our economy and society.
